The challenge

Nike needed content that spoke to real runners, from 5am club sessions to race morning, without losing the energy of the product drop.

My approach

I embedded with the run club and shot on the move: cadence-matched edits, split times on screen, and honest race-day moments. Each piece doubled as a product story and a reason to lace up.

Challenge

Porsche wanted launch content that felt cinematic on a phone screen, not a cut-down of the TV spot. The footage had to hold attention in the first two seconds.

Solution

I planned each shoot around the drive itself: golden-hour roads, tight tracking shots, and sound-led edits. Every clip shipped in vertical and wide, ready for Reels, Shorts and the feed.
